A Day at Vassar

For the second year, the college opens its doors—and its campus—to friends and neighbors in the Hudson Valley (not to mention alumnae/i, faculty members, staff, and other members of the Vassar community) for A Day at Vassar. The day-long event—which takes place on Saturday, October 13—includes more than 40 lectures, musical performances, art exhibitions, and more. Registration closes Tuesday, October 9. Read More …

In Search of the Real Cuba

More than forty students traveled to the Caribbean nation of Cuba for the International Studies course “Cuban Transitions: Heritage, Ecotourism, and Cultural Transformations in the 21st Century.” Read More …

Gloria Steinem Visits Vassar

This year, Ms. magazine celebrates 40 years of publication. As part of an anniversary tour, founder and noted feminist Gloria Steinem delivered a lecture in the Vassar Chapel. Read More …

A Native American Perspective

On September 22, two performances of CEDARS, a staged reading of poems and texts by Native American writers, were held in the Streep Auditorium on campus, featuring Native actors. Read More …
